Energy markets were particularly volatile as investors balanced fears of supply disruptions through the Strait of Hormuz\u2014one of the world\u2019s most critical oil transit routes\u2014against occasional indications that tensions might ease. Investor confidence was also weakened by growing worries about potential stress in private credit markets and ongoing developments in global trade policy. The S&amp;P 500 declined 1.6%, the Dow Jones Industrial Average fell 1.91%, and the Nasdaq 100 lost 1.06%, as investors reassessed the global macro-outlook. Economic reports showed mixed signals on inflation and growth. Year-over-year core inflation remained at 2.5%, while the broader consumer price index increased 0.3% for the month and 2.4% from a year earlier. Meanwhile, the Bureau of Economic Analysis reported that the Federal Reserve\u2019s preferred inflation gauge, the core Personal Consumption Expenditures Price Index increased to 3.1% year-on-year, marking the highest level since early 2024. Economic growth data was also revised downward. The second estimate for fourth-quarter Gross Domestic Product showed the U.S. economy expanding at a 0.7% annual pace rather than the earlier estimate of 1.4%. Moving to the other side of the Atlantic, European stocks edged lower amid heightened uncertainty. The STOXX Europe 600 declined 0.11% for the week as investors focused on the possible duration of the Middle East conflict and the implications of higher energy costs for economic growth. Christine Lagarde, head of the European Central Bank, said the institution stands ready to act to keep inflation under control if higher energy prices persist. In the United Kingdom, economic growth stalled in January according to the Office for National Statistics. GDP was unchanged for the month, missing expectations for a modest increase. While retail and wholesale trade provided some support, declines in administrative and support services offset those gains. In Asia, Japanese equities declined during the week, with the Nikkei 225 falling 3.24% and the TOPIX losing 2.36%. Rising oil prices linked to tensions near the Strait of Hormuz increased concerns about energy supply, particularly because Japan relies heavily on imports from the Middle East. Prime Minister Sanae Takaichi announced plans to release part of Japan\u2019s strategic oil reserves\u2014held by both the government and private firms\u2014to reduce the risk of supply shortages. Chinese stock markets showed mixed performance. The CSI 300 rose slightly, while the Shanghai Composite Index declined. Consumer prices increased at the fastest rate in more than three years. The consumer price index rose 1.3% year over year in February, boosted by strong spending during the Lunar New Year holiday period. At the same time, China\u2019s exports jumped 21.8% during the first two months of the year compared with the same period in 2025, exceeding expectations.
